If somoene else on my verizon plan has an upgrade, can i take it from them if i have edge and they take my phone? will it cost extra besdies the upgrade fee?

You do not have to give up your contract phone if you are taking another user's upgrade. They lose their upgrade and are stuck for 2 years in that contract. But, if you are taking another's upgrade, that affects their line, not yours. If you were Early Upgrading, then yes, you would have to turn in the current contract/DPP phone. I do not believe you can transfer a phone on DPP to another user without having paid off that phone first, otherwise you just keep paying for that phone until paid off. You'd probably want to sell that phone rather than trade for an upgrade and pay for 2 phones. Remember, the person who takes the upgrade is having to pay $20 more a month on access charges for a phone they don't have. Of course, if your DPP amount is near $20, then it could be a fair trade for a few months.
